Top Industries to Start in India 2026 Transformer oil is a type of specialized oil that is used as an insulation and cooling medium in electrical transformers. It is a mineral-based oil, which may be composed of synthetic hydrocarbons, vegetable or animal oils, or silicone. It is mainly used in power and distribution transformers, in which it helps to cool down the coils, prevent breakdowns, and ensure proper insulation of the transformer. Transformer oil has excellent electrical insulating properties and does not react with the copper windings of the transformer. Application of Transformer oil Transformer oil, or insulating oil, is a highly refined mineral oil used in transformers and other electrical equipment. It is typically used to cool and insulate the components of these devices. It also provides protection against water and moisture, which can cause short-circuiting, sparking and arcing. Transformer oils are also used to clean and lubricate components. Transformer oil is used in a variety of industries including electricity generation, telecommunications, and industrial machinery. Global Market Outlook The global transformer oil market size was valued at USD 2.1 billion in 2022 and is expected to expand at a compound annual growth rate (CAGR) of 12.5% from 2023 to 2030. This is attributed to growth in the global power sector and advancement of electric grids in emerging countries. Every power and distribution transformer is filled with dielectric insulating fluid, which has a strong resistance to electricity and keeps the transformer cool. Setup Plant OF Mica Powder from Mica Deposits Mica powder is a fine, powdery mineral that is made from mica deposits. Mica is a type of natural rock that is composed of various minerals including silicon dioxide, magnesium, and aluminium. It has been used for centuries in various products due to its special qualities such as shine, light reflectivity, and colour range. Mica powder is created through a process called micronization where the mica is grinded into a fine powder. How Is Mica Powder Made From Mica Deposits? Mica powder is made from mica deposits that are mined from the earth. The mica mineral is first extracted from the deposit and then further processed to extract the mica flakes, which are then ground into a fine powder. The mica powder is often used in cosmetics, paints, and other products due to its versatility and high-shine finish. Setup Plant of Acetate Tow for Cigarette Filters Acetate tow is a type of material used in the cigarette industry to make filters. It is made of cellulose acetate fibers, which are very thin, strong, and resilient. This type of material has been around for decades and is now widely used to manufacture cigarette filters. A Business Plan for Silica Gel Crystal & Beads from Sodium Silicate and Sulphuric Acid Silica Gel crystals and beads, derived from sodium silicate and sulphuric acid, are small porous granules made of silica. The process of manufacturing these granules begins by combining sodium silicate (Na?SiO?) and sulphuric acid (H?SO?) in a reactor, where the resulting liquid product is filtered and dried. This yields a fine powder that can be shaped into granules of various sizes.
